## Support

Welcome aboard! DocSentry is our documentation linter — it checks style, broken cross-references, and heading structure across all the Fernwick docs repos. As a new contractor, you'll mostly interact with it via the pre-commit hook; if it flags something confusing, the rules are documented in `RULES.md` with examples. False positives happen, especially with code blocks inside tables, so don't burn hours fighting it. Suppress with an inline comment and file a ticket. For anything else, ping the docs tooling crew here.

escalation mailbox, bafog-fafog: ulador@paliqlabs.internal

As release manager, you gate every Harborline release through Squatwatch, our typo-squatting scanner. It compares new dependencies against the internal registry, flags near-miss names, and blocks publishes with unresolved findings. Overrides require a written justification in the release ticket. Scanner policies and the allowlist live in the Duskmoor admin panel; most changes are self-serve. If your admin account is ever locked out mid-release, use the emergency recovery flow with the passphrase below.

vault phrase of kawep-tahog = ulaix-briath

Q: Why is the Quicktern autocomplete index slow after deploys?

A: The index rebuilds cold on every deploy; warm it with the prewarm job before routing traffic. Shard counts are fixed at eight — don't change them without a migration. Prewarm credentials live in the sealed ops vault; unseal it with the recovery passphrase below.

unlock words, fafop-hawep: briwyn-oliix-sorox

Ticket: Staging env misconfigured for Siftgate bloom filter

The bloom layer in front of the Pellet KV store is rejecting all lookups in staging because the env file was copied from the dev template without credentials. False-positive tuning values are fine; only the auth line is missing. To unblock the weekly demo, the Pellet admission secret must be set on the following line.

env line for yaguf-fajop: LEDGER_TOKEN13=fb08984397349